Im digitalen Zeitalter ist die Ladegeschwindigkeit von Webseiten entscheidend für ein positives Nutzererlebnis. Besonders wichtig ist hierbei der Umgang mit Bildern, die aufgrund technischer Probleme möglicherweise nicht richtig geladen werden. Um sicherzustellen, dass Ihre Webseite auch im Falle von Bildproblemen ansprechend bleibt, können Sie eine entsprechende Fehlerbehandlung implementieren.

Fehlerbehandlung für Bilder

Eine häufige Technik zur Verbesserung der Benutzererfahrung ist die Verwendung von Platzhalter- oder Fallback-Bildern. Wenn ein Bild nicht geladen werden kann, wird automatisch ein alternatives Bild angezeigt. Die folgende Funktion in JavaScript demonstriert, wie dies umgesetzt werden kann:

function imageLoadError(img) {
    const fallbackImage="/media/sites/cnn/cnn-fallback-image.jpg";

    img.removeAttribute('onerror');
    img.src = fallbackImage;
    let element = img.previousElementSibling;

    while (element && element.tagName === 'SOURCE') {
      element.srcset = fallbackImage;
      element = element.previousElementSibling;
    }
}

So funktioniert die Funktion

In dieser Funktion wird zuerst ein Fallback-Bild definiert, das angezeigt wird, wenn das ursprüngliche Bild nicht geladen werden kann. Die Funktion entfernt zudem das onerror-Attribut, um einen erneuten Fehler zu vermeiden.

Durch das Durchlaufen der vorhergehenden Elemente wird sichergestellt, dass auch in den Tags SOURCE, die für unterschiedliche Bildschirmgrößen oder -auflösungen gedacht sind, das Fallback-Bild gesetzt wird. Dadurch bleibt das Layout und die Ästhetik der Webseite erhalten, selbst wenn Probleme beim Laden von Bildressourcen auftreten.

Die Bedeutung von visuellen Inhalten

Bilder spielen eine Schlüsselrolle in der visuellen Kommunikation und im Storytelling auf Webseiten. Sie fangen die Aufmerksamkeit der Besucher ein und tragen zur Markenidentität bei. Daher ist es entscheidend, sicherzustellen, dass diese Ressource stets optimal präsentiert wird. Wenn Bilder nicht geladen werden, kann dies das gesamte Nutzererlebnis beeinflussen und dazu führen, dass Besucher die Webseite schnell wieder verlassen.

Die Verwendung von Fallback-Bildern ist eine einfache, jedoch äußerst effektive Methode, um die Zuverlässigkeit Ihrer Webseite zu erhöhen und eine konsistente Nutzererfahrung zu garantieren.

Fazit

Die Implementierung einer robusten Fehlerbehandlungslogik für Bilder trägt nicht nur zur Verbesserung der Benutzererfahrung bei, sondern ist auch ein wichtiger Aspekt der Webseitenoptimierung. Durch den Einsatz von Fallback-Bildern können Sie sicherstellen, dass Ihre Webseite immer ansprechend bleibt, selbst wenn technische Schwierigkeiten auftreten.

Denken Sie daran, dass eine funktionierende Webseite Für Besucher ebenso wichtig ist wie die visuelle Gestaltung. Schützen Sie Ihre Webseite vor Bildfehlern und optimieren Sie die wahrgenommene Qualität Ihres Contents!

Frederic J. Brown/AFP/Getty Images